
Construction Sales Account Manager
Waste Management, Sacramento, CA, United States
Job Summary
Generates revenue growth by utilizing a consultative selling approach in the retention of current WM customers. Manages existing business relationships in order to achieve budgeted sales goals by developing and implementing sound retention strategies, utilizing strong negotiation efforts to preserve business, and securing contract agreements from previously non‑contracted customers. The Account Manager will "save, secure, and convert" by handling all customer cancellation requests, providing ongoing education of contract details to existing customers, and by obtaining customer contract commitments during face‑to‑face interactions. All escalations for customer service within the defined territory will be resolved through this position.
This position will require the employee to conduct customer site visits the majority of the week with the rest of the week in‑office.

About Us WM (WM.com) is North America’s largest comprehensive waste management environmental solutions provider. Previously known as Waste Management and based in Houston, Texas, WM is driven by commitments to put people first and achieve success with integrity. The company, through its subsidiaries, provides collection, recycling and disposal services to millions of residential, commercial, industrial and municipal customers throughout the U.S. and Canada. With innovative infrastructure and capabilities in recycling, organics and renewable energy, WM provides environmental solutions to and collaborates with its customers in helping them achieve their sustainability goals. WM has the largest disposal network and collection fleet in North America, is the largest recycler of post‑consumer materials and is the leader in beneficial reuse of landfill gas, with a growing network of renewable natural gas plants and the most gas‑to‑electricity plants in North America. WM’s fleet includes nearly 11,000 natural gas trucks – the largest heavy‑duty natural gas truck fleet of its kind in North America – where more than half are fueled by renewable natural gas.
